Cosmos: An Enchanting Realm of Wonder
Cosmos, coined by Greek philosopher Pythagoras, signifies the harmoniously ordered universe. It encompasses the entirety of space and time, embracing everything from the subatomic particles within atoms to the grandest galaxies.
